📅  最后修改于: 2023-12-03 14:51:50.502000             🧑  作者: Mango
Apache Hadoop 是一个开源的分布式计算框架,用于处理大规模数据集并运行分布式应用程序。在使用 Hadoop 开发和调试应用程序时,可以将 Eclipse 配置为一个方便的集成开发环境(IDE)。
下面是在 Eclipse 中配置和使用 Apache Hadoop 的步骤:
首先,你需要下载并安装适用于你的操作系统的 Eclipse IDE。你可以从 Eclipse 官方网站上下载最新的 Eclipse 版本。
在开始配置 Eclipse 之前,你需要下载和配置 Apache Hadoop。你可以从 Apache Hadoop 的官方网站上下载最新的稳定版本,并按照官方文档进行安装和配置。
在 Eclipse 中创建一个新的 Java 项目或打开一个现有的项目,然后将 Hadoop 的 JAR 文件添加到项目的构建路径中。你可以在 Hadoop 的安装目录中找到这些 JAR 文件。这些文件通常位于 Hadoop 的 lib 目录下。
在 Eclipse 中,右键点击项目名称,选择 "Properties"(属性)选项。在弹出的窗口中,选择 "Java Build Path"(Java 构建路径)选项卡。选择 "Libraries"(库)选项卡,然后点击 "Add External JARs"(添加外部 JAR)按钮。在对话框中浏览并选择 Hadoop JAR 文件,然后点击 "OK" 完成添加。
在 Eclipse 中运行 Hadoop 应用程序之前,你需要配置 Hadoop 的运行参数。这些参数通常包括 Hadoop 的配置文件和输入/输出路径。
在 Eclipse 的项目资源视图中,找到项目的 Hadoop 配置文件。这个文件通常是一个 XML 文件,名称类似于 "core-site.xml" 或 "hdfs-site.xml"。右键点击文件名称,选择 "Properties"(属性)选项。在 "Resource"(资源)选项卡中,找到 "Location"(位置)属性,并记住该位置。
在 Eclipse 中,选择 "Run"(运行)菜单,然后选择 "Run Configurations"(运行配置)选项。在弹出的窗口中,选择 "Java Application"(Java 应用程序)选项,然后点击 "New"(新建)按钮创建一个新的运行配置。
在新的运行配置中,选择 "Arguments"(参数)选项卡,并在 "VM arguments"(VM 参数)字段中添加以下参数:
-Dhadoop.home.dir=/path/to/hadoop
-Dhadoop.config.dir=/path/to/hadoop/conf
将 "/path/to/hadoop" 替换为你实际的 Hadoop 安装目录路径。
在 Eclipse 中,右键点击你的 Hadoop 应用程序的主类,然后选择 "Run As"(运行为)选项,选择 "Java Application"(Java 应用程序)。这将使用之前配置的运行参数来运行你的 Hadoop 应用程序。
使用 Eclipse 配置和开发 Apache Hadoop 应用程序可以帮助你更方便地进行开发和调试。遵循上述步骤,你可以快速地配置 Eclipse 和 Hadoop,并在 Eclipse 中启动和运行你的 Hadoop 应用程序。
注意:为了能够成功运行 Hadoop 应用程序,你的机器上必须正确安装和配置了 Hadoop,并拥有足够的系统资源。